It’s coming: Balthazar Boulangerie



I won’t quite believe this ’til I see it with my own eyes, but here goes anyway. The opening of Balthazar, the London chapter is imminent (so we’re told), but first we’re getting Balthazar Boulangerie on February 6th. That’s next week!*

According to Zagat.com, the famous New York brasserie will open its bakery next Wednesday selling oven-warm goodies to take away. Situated next to the main restaurant in Russell Street, this will keep us fed until Balthazar proper opens it doors. I’ve been holding my breath for years for Balthazar London so this will bring it a little closer. And just in time for LFW too…

*UPDATE: Opening delayed until Monday 11th. what a tease!

Balthazar Boulangerie, 8 Russell Street, London WC2B 5HZ. Weekdays: 7am – 8pm. Saturdays: 11am – 6pm

Laduree opens in Covent Garden



Laduree Covent Garden

Is this the chicest china in WC2? Laduree has opened a Covent Garden outpost in the heart of The Piazza with a balcony overlooking the buskers. It joins the newly opened Burberry Brit store (a minute away in King Street) and the soon-to-come Balthazar in the ‘Opera Quarter’, due this autumn.
